Cost of Drainage Construction in Nashville
The cost of drainage construction in Nashville, TN, can vary significantly based on a range of factors. Whether you are dealing with residential or commercial properties, understanding these cost determinants is essential for effective budgeting and planning. From the type of drainage system to the complexity of the installation, several elements play a role in shaping the overall expense.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Type of Drainage System: Different systems, such as French drains, surface drains, or subsurface drains, have varying costs.
- Property Size: Larger properties typically require more extensive drainage solutions, increasing the overall cost.
- Soil Type: The nature of the soil can affect the ease of installation and the materials needed, impacting the cost.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Nashville, TN, can influence the total expenditure.
- Permits and Regulations: Compliance with local codes and obtaining necessary permits can add to the cost.
- Materials Used: The quality and type of materials chosen for the drainage system can significantly affect the price.
- Accessibility: Difficult-to-reach areas may require specialized equipment or additional labor, increasing cost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Nashville, TN) |
---|---|
French Drain Installation | $3,000 - $5,000 |
Surface Drain Installation | $1,500 - $3,000 |
Subsurface Drain Installation | $4,000 - $7,000 |
Soil Testing | $300 - $600 |
Permits | $100 - $300 |
Excavation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Material Costs (per linear foot) | $10 - $30 |
Labor Costs (per hour) | $50 - $100 |
